I disagree. Feeback should be based on how you conduct yourself throughout the entire sale. I almost always leave my buyers feedback after they acknowledge they have received the item and are happy with it. Theres too many nightmare buyers who might pay immediatley but then decide once they have the item that they want a refund (usually as they've not bothered to read the description or they have buyers remorse) and then send offensive emails - why should they get a positive for that? If I'd left them a positive then they'd just try to hold me to randsom over it.

The whole feedback system is flawed though as too many people are scared to neg incase they get one in return (like Rob). I think theres too many people (me included) who take too much pride in their 100% record. Maybe this should be revised but I don't know what would work better.
